ICL Phosphate Specialty - HALOX®
HALOX® SZP-391 JM
Chemical Family:
Phosphosilicates, Strontium & Strontium Compounds, Zinc & Zinc Compounds
Functions:
Pigment, Corrosion Inhibitor
Compatible Polymers & Resins:
Alkyds, Polyvinylidene Chloride (PVDC), Epoxies (EP), Polyesters
HALOX® SZP-391 JM is an efficient and versatile corrosion-inhibiting pigment. It is a white, nonrefractive, corrosion-inhibiting pigment used in protective coating systems. HALOX® SZP-391 JM is equally effective in such resins as alkyds (both traditional and high solids), epoxies, latexes, water-reducible alkyds, high acid value resins, catalyzed baking systems, and vinylidene chloride-based latexes and is recommended for use in a wide variety of resin systems.

Minex® ST 4 A100-10
Functions:
Extender, Filler
End Uses:
Top Coat, Primer
Minex® ST 4 A100-10 is a functional filler that is produced from nepheline syenite, a naturally occurring, silica-deficient sodium-potassium alumina silicate. Automated scanning electron microscopy confirms that Minex® ST grades contain less than one-tenth of one percent crystalline silica. No free crystalline silica is detectable in the mineral complex. All Minex® ST grades are processed and sized with rigid adherence to Covia’s QIPSM quality assurance programs.

Suncolor Corporation
SUNSPHERES™ 200 Nm
Functions:
Reinforcement, Filler
Chemical Family:
Calcium Salts, Silica
End Uses:
Radiation Curable Coating, Primer, Waterborne Coating, Marine Applications, Lighting Applications, Solventless & High Solids Coating, Aerospace Applications, Enamel
Sunspheres™ 200 Nm are optically clear, solid fused amorphous microspheres designed for use in a wide variety of coatings, inks, adhesives, powder coatings, and thermoplastics, including UV curable compositions. These sub-micron sized spheres can be used to improve physical and mechanical properties including reduced shrinkage, improved adhesion, impact resistance, and enhanced surface qualities such as hardness, mar and scratch resistance. The average particle size is 200 nanometers and range in size from about 50 nm to 500 nm.

WPC Technologies
WPC Technologies Strontium Chromate 177
Applications:
Aerospace & Aviation, Primers & Lacquers, Aerospace Coatings
Product Families:
Corrosion Inhibiting Pigments, Functional Pigments
Chemical Family:
Chromates
End Uses:
Waterborne Coating, Solventless & High Solids Coating, Solventborne Coating
WPC Technologies Strontium Chromate 177, with the chemical formula of SrCr04, is a low dust and very low oil absorption corrosion inhibitor pigment. It is recommended for high solids primer formulations. It is characterized by a unique high apparent bulk density and is widely used in aerospace primers for aluminum protection.

WPC Technologies
Hybricor™ 204 - Hybrid Corrosion Inhibitor Pigment
Applications:
Aerospace & Aviation, Primers & Lacquers, Aerospace Coatings
Product Families:
Functional Pigments, Corrosion Inhibiting Pigments, Pigments & Colorants
End Uses:
Solventborne Coating, Primer
Hybricor™ 204 - Hybrid Corrosion Inhibitor Pigment is an organic/inorganic hybrid corrosion inhibitor pigment, a proven effective replacement for Cr6+ in aerospace primer applications on aluminum and other non-ferrous substrates. The fine particle size of Hybricor™ 204 (7 Hegman) permits it to be easily incorporated into a coating using a high speed disperser. It is effective in primers, DTM and thin film (< 20 micron) applications. It does not affect pot life of 2K systems. Use level varies by intended application requirements.
